6``Tracers in Ocean Paradigm'' (\TOP) is the passive tracers engine of
7the \NEMO\ ocean model (``Nucleus for European Modelling of the Ocean'').
8It is intended to be a flexible tool for studying the on/offline oceanic tracers transport and
9the biogeochemical processes (``green ocean''),
10as well as its interactions with the other components of the Earth climate system over
11a wide range of space and time scales.
12\TOP\ is interfaced with the \NEMO\ ocean engine, and,
13via the \href{http://portal.enes.org/oasis}{OASIS} coupler,
14with several atmospheric general circulation models.

18This component provides the physical constraints and boundaries conditions for
19oceanic tracers transport and represents a generalized, hardwired interface toward
20biogeochemical models to enable a seamless coupling.
21In particular, transport dynamics are supplied by the ocean dynamical core thus
22enabling the use of all available advection and diffusion schemes in both on- and off-line modes.
23\TOP\ is designed to handle multiple oceanic tracers through a modular approach and
24it includes different sub-modules: ocean water age, inorganic carbon (CFCs) \& radiocarbon (C14b),
25built-in biogeochemical model (PISCES), and prototype for user-defined cases or
26coupling with alternative biogeochemical models (\eg \href{http://www.bfm-community.eu}{BFM}).
